Quantum Amplitude Interpolation

arXiv:2203.08758

Abstract

In this paper we present a method for representing continuous signals with high precision by interpolating quantum state amplitudes. The method is inspired by the Nyquist-Shannon sampling theorem, which links continuous and discrete time signals. This method extends our previous method of computing generalized inner products from integer-valued functions to real-valued functions.
